Hackness, Burton Fleming, Winestead, Blacktoft and Scorborough Parish Registers 1538-1812

Hackness is in the North Riding of Yorkshire; Burton Fleming, Winestead, Blacktoft and Scorborough are in the East Riding of Yorkshire Contains a complete transcript of the entries in the registers of Christenings, Marriages and Burials for Hackness 1557 - 1783 Burton Fleming 1538 - 1812 Winestead 1578 - 1812 Blacktoft 1700 - 1812 and Scorborough 1653 - 1812

Helmsley - Reminiscences of 100 years ago

A super A5 book about Helmsley, written by Isaac Cooper a little over 100 years ago, in which he recounts not only his own memories, but some stories handed down to him and extracts from the diary of John Pape, a noted diarist of the 18th century, giving us a real insight into life in the town from the middle eighteenth up to the late nineteenth centuries.  Isaac Cooper first published his book in…
